Electro-Hydraulic MDF Kit Valve Activator for High-Power Industrial Machinery with Superior Force Density
Product Description:
The Electro-Hydraulic MDF Kit Valve Activator delivers unparalleled power in a compact package, making it the ideal solution for high-force applications where electrical control is preferred but pure hydraulic power is required. This integrated unit combines an electric motor, a self-contained hydraulic pump, and a hydraulic cylinder into a single, robust actuator. It generates immense linear force—far greater than a similarly sized pneumatic or electric actuator—making it perfect for operating large gate valves, shear rams, or heavy-duty clamping mechanisms in metal forming, mining, and heavy construction machinery. The key advantage is its superior force density, providing tremendous output from a relatively small footprint. It offers precise control over speed and position while delivering the smooth, powerful motion characteristic of hydraulic systems. Since it is a closed-loop system, it eliminates the need for expensive and messy external hydraulic power units and hoses, reducing installation complexity and potential leak points. FAQ
1. What is the primary benefit of superior force density?
Superior force density means you can achieve a very high force output from a much smaller and lighter actuator compared to other technologies, saving space and weight in your machinery design.
2. Can this actuator hold a position under load indefinitely?
Yes, due to the inherent nature of hydraulic systems, it can hold a position and sustain a static load without consuming any energy, making it highly efficient for clamping and pressing applications in high-power industrial machinery.
3. How is maintenance handled on a self-contained unit?
Maintenance primarily involves periodic checks of the hydraulic fluid quality and level. The unit is designed for long service intervals, and seal kits are available for planned maintenance.
4. What is the typical stroke length for this type of linear actuation?
Stroke lengths are customizable, but standard models are available for linear actuation strokes from a few centimeters up to several hundred millimeters, suitable for most industrial valve and clamp applications.
5. What are the power requirements?
It typically operates on standard three-phase AC power (e.g., 400V/50Hz or 480V/60Hz) to drive the internal motor and pump efficiently.
